Consider using a French press for brewing rich, flavorful coffee. Drip coffee makers use paper filters that can retain coffee’s natural oils, robbing the final product of flavor. French presses brew coffee by forcing beans downward, essentially “pressing” the flavor from the beans. The oils remain in the brew, lending a richer flavor.

The type of water used to brew coffee can easily alter taste. Water may seem insignificant, but every little thing matters when it comes to coffee. Thus, bottled or filtered water make the best choices when brewing coffee.
It is not necessary to keep coffee in your freezer. You may not realize it, but coffee can take on the smell and flavors of food it is near. It is ideal to store coffee at room temperature inside an airtight container. If you must freeze it or put it in the fridge, at least use a freezer bag.
Overly warm places, such as above the oven, should never be used to store coffee. Heat saps the flavor out of your coffee very quickly. Any counter tops or cupboards near the oven should be avoided.
